Вопрос задан 29.10.2023 в 04:52. Предмет Информатика. Спрашивает Черноморд Ника.

С клавиатуры вводится целое положительное (может быть равно 0) число B, не превышающее 30 000.

Напиши программу, которая считает и выводит на экран сумму цифр числа B. (для паскаля)
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Константинова Каринэ.

Ответ:

var B, s: integer;

begin

 write('Введите целое число B: ');

 read(B);

 s := 0;

 while B > 0 do

 begin

   s := s + B mod 10;

   B := B div 10;

 end;

 writeln('Сумма цифр числа равна ',s);

end.

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.
Здравствуйте, это Bing. Я могу помочь вам написать программу на языке Паскаль, которая считает и выводит на экран сумму цифр числа B. Вот примерный алгоритм решения задачи: - Объявить переменную B типа integer и считать ее значение с клавиатуры. - Объявить переменную S типа integer и присвоить ей значение 0. Эта переменная будет хранить сумму цифр числа B. - Пока B больше 0, повторять следующие действия: - Найти остаток от деления B на 10. Это будет последняя цифра числа B. - Прибавить этот остаток к S. - Разделить B нацело на 10. Это уберет последнюю цифру из числа B. - Вывести значение S на экран. Вот пример кода на языке Паскаль, который реализует этот алгоритм: ```pascal program SumOfDigits; var B, S: integer; begin readln(B); // считать значение B с клавиатуры S := 0; // присвоить S значение 0 while B > 0 do // пока B больше 0 begin S := S + (B mod 10); // прибавить к S остаток от деления B на 10 B := B div 10; // разделить B нацело на 10 end; writeln(S); // вывести значение S на экран end. ``` Надеюсь, это поможет вам решить задачу. Удачи! ????
0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ос